### What Are Sandwich Bots?

A **sandwich bot** is an automatic buying and selling bot created to benefit from slippage in token trades on DEXs. The bot executes a sequence of trades that surrounds a large, pending transaction, manipulating the token selling price in this type of way that it earnings both equally before and once the focus on trade is executed.

Here's how it works in exercise:

1. **Front-operate the transaction**: The bot identifies a substantial pending trade on a DEX, such as Uniswap or PancakeSwap, and submits a purchase get with an increased gas rate to guarantee it will get processed first. This will cause the price of the token to increase before the sufferer’s transaction is executed.

2. **Target's trade is executed**: The target’s trade, which often involves swapping tokens with a few slippage tolerance, is then processed. As a result of bot’s entrance-operate, the victim ends up having to pay a better value for the tokens.

3. **Again-run the transaction**: Immediately following the sufferer's trade is completed, the bot submits a promote get, capitalizing within the artificially inflated price a result of the front-operate and also the sufferer’s transaction. The bot exits the trade using a earnings as the value stabilizes.

This process transpires within just milliseconds and calls for the bot to be remarkably efficient in monitoring the blockchain and executing transactions.

### How Sandwich Bots Get the job done: A Detailed Breakdown

Permit’s stop working the sandwiching procedure bit by bit to understand how these bots purpose on-chain.

#### 1. **Mempool Checking**
Sandwich bots continuously keep track of the **mempool**, and that is the holding spot for unconfirmed transactions. The objective should be to detect huge trades that could have an effect on token charges resulting from liquidity slippage. These big trades typically come about on DEXs like Uniswap, Sushiswap, or PancakeSwap, where current market orders can transfer prices based on the size with the trade relative towards the liquidity obtainable.

#### 2. **Front-Jogging**
Once the bot detects a substantial trade, it places a **get get** just prior to the sufferer’s trade. The bot accomplishes this by setting a greater gas fee to be certain its transaction gets processed ahead of the target’s. This raises the token cost slightly before the target’s trade is executed, effectively manipulating the cost.

#### 3. **Price Inflation**
The sufferer’s transaction is then processed, and because of the entrance-run purchase, they finish up shelling out a greater cost than originally predicted. This slippage happens because the bot’s get order reduces the out there liquidity, pushing the token price tag bigger.

#### 4. **Back again-Operating**
Instantly after the sufferer’s trade is finished, the bot submits a **market buy** within the inflated price. This process is termed **back-managing**. The bot capitalizes to the elevated token selling price due to the entrance-operate and exits the situation with a profit. As the token cost returns to its first stage, the bot has finished its "sandwich" of the victim’s trade.

### Components That Influence Sandwich Bot Results

Quite a few crucial factors identify the usefulness of a sandwich bot:

1. **Gas Service fees and Velocity**
A sandwich bot’s accomplishment mainly depends MEV BOT tutorial upon how swiftly it could possibly execute transactions. Because blockchain transactions are requested depending on gas service fees (on networks like Ethereum and copyright Intelligent Chain), the bot need to supply greater fuel expenses to be certain its entrance-run get is processed ahead of the concentrate on transaction. Even so, gas costs need to be carefully managed to guarantee they don’t try to eat into gains.

two. **Liquidity and Slippage**
The success of sandwich bots boosts in low-liquidity swimming pools. When liquidity is minimal, even smaller trades might cause considerable slippage, which makes it much easier to the bot to make the most of value alterations. Conversely, substantial liquidity swimming pools may well not provide adequate slippage for the bot to generate significant revenue.

3. **Trade Measurement**
Larger trades create much more substantial selling price movements, that makes them a lot more attractive targets for sandwich bots. Each time a trader submits a considerable marketplace purchase, the cost impact is more pronounced, creating bigger possibilities for sandwich bots to revenue.

four. **Community Congestion**
On networks like Ethereum, in which congestion is Regular, transaction speed and gas optimization come to be all the more critical. For the duration of intervals of higher congestion, the cost of entrance-operating and again-managing can improve considerably, making it challenging to stay lucrative.

### Moral Factors and Dangers

Though sandwich bots might be highly successful, They may be thought of controversial and infrequently predatory in the DeFi Neighborhood. Sandwiching results in legitimate traders to shed money a result of the value manipulation that happens in the event the bot inflates price ranges right before their trade. This manipulation undermines the fairness and believe in of decentralized marketplaces.

Also, using sandwich bots can lead to greater gas selling prices, as bots generally have interaction in fuel bidding wars to protected favorable transaction get placement.

#### Hazards of Using Sandwich Bots
one. **Level of competition**
The Opposition amid sandwich bots is intense, In particular on well-known blockchains. Many bots could target the identical transaction, resulting in higher gasoline fees that will erode gains. Moreover, In the event the victim’s transaction is delayed or fails, the bot could be trapped holding tokens at an inflated cost, bringing about losses.

two. **Failed Transactions**
If the bot fails to entrance-operate the victim’s trade or Should the back again-run purchase fails, it might incur losses. Unsuccessful trades don't just Expense gasoline expenses but in addition probably leave the bot subjected to selling price volatility.

3. **Regulatory and Ethical Scrutiny**
Whilst decentralized and permissionless, DeFi markets are not cost-free from regulatory scrutiny. Sandwiching tactics is usually witnessed as industry manipulation, and when regulators focus on these actions, there could be authorized ramifications for bot operators.

### The way to Protect In opposition to Sandwich Bots

For traders, it is necessary to concentrate on sandwich bots and get techniques to attenuate the chances of falling sufferer to them. Here are some procedures to protect towards sandwiching:

one. **Restrict Orders**
Employing Restrict orders in place of marketplace orders on DEXs can help traders keep away from staying sandwiched. A Restrict order specifies the exact price tag at which a trade should be executed, minimizing the chance of cost manipulation.

2. **Slippage Tolerance Options**
Traders can change the slippage tolerance settings on DEXs. Decrease slippage tolerance reduces the probability that a trade will be front-run, even though it also improves the opportunity the trade received’t be executed in the least throughout unstable durations.

3. **Private Transactions**
Some DeFi platforms and instruments enable traders to submit private transactions that bypass the mempool, which makes it harder for bots to detect and entrance-operate their trades.

4. **Flashbots and MEV Safety**
Resources like **Flashbots** (initially created for Ethereum) let traders to connect with miners directly, stopping their transactions from getting noticeable in the public mempool. This gets rid of the power of sandwich bots to entrance-operate or back again-operate these trades.
